Set in the misty hills of Nainital, Manju follows Vimala, a schoolteacher waiting indefinitely for her lover, Sudhir. MT's poetic prose perfectly captures the loneliness of the human heart, using the mountain mist as a metaphor for the blurred boundaries of hope and memory. 8. Nalukettu (The Ancestral House) – M. T.
